Late Heroics Lift Baylor Lacrosse Past Defending Champs
Baylor Lacrosse delivered a statement win Thursday night, edging defending public school state champion Nolensville 11-10 in a thrilling finish on the road.
In a game filled with momentum swings, the Red Raiders showed resilience from start to finish against one of the top programs in the state.
Baylor's offense was balanced and explosive throughout the night. Hunter Rosser led the charge with four goals, while Rice and Robbins each added two scores to keep the pressure on the Nolensville defense.
When the moment called for it, Baylor delivered.
Trailing late, Henry Kelle stepped up with a clutch tying goal to even the match and set the stage for a dramatic finish.
Then, in the final seconds, Baylor found its hero.
With just 20 seconds remaining, Will Mayberry buried the game-winner, sealing an 11-10 victory and capping off an impressive road win over the defending champs.
The Red Raiders' ability to execute in critical moments and stay composed late proved to be the difference in a high-level matchup.
A big-time win for Baylor as they continue to build momentum early in the season.
